Re: nyys Battle Reports *Groks Rule 6/8*
nyys
Gorillinators x3 Nakitas Q9 Theracus 610 little nyys Braxas Groks x2 MBS NGS 610 Before this match started I had to shake my head in shame a little when I realized what had been selected for armies. I had Q9, and the little guy had Groks, that's all that really needs to be said. But I let it go, figured everyone needs to go through it themselves with the fragile Marro riders. Fast forward to the end of the game and lets just say my son was enjoying fried Gorillinator, sprinkled with Nakita, in a pan made from spare Q9 parts. I played the map like I would in a tourney setting since A Chill in the Air is up for BoV review. My son, well, I was expecting more of the same, bad OM management, and agressively sending out units to have them get cut down from range. Um no... that's not exactly how it went. It was actually quite enjoyable to watch, as tactically, he made sound move after sound move. He bonded MBS with the Groks the first couple turns, and went after the Nakitas, paralyzing and then killing two right away (so much for my Gorillinator meat shield). While I'm recovering from that (trying to get OMs on the Nators to start choppin gup Groks), he sends Braxas right at Q9 (this was after he whiffed on all three rolls - twice - on MBS and the Groks), and engages him. Now my best figure has to cut through an 8-life Dragon before he can set-up a protective line of fire for the Nators. So Q9 and Braxas exchange blows for a few OMs, all while the Groks, backed by MBS crash into the nators with thier attack bonus (that bumps them to five). Even with Tough, the Nators fell often and quickly. I managed to put a little hurt on MBS, and took down two Groks, but the damage had been done. Q9 put a lot of hurt on Braxas, but the big beastie was able to take down the Major in the end. Now it was time for Braxas to party as she made quick work of what was left of the Nators. When the dust had settled... nyys' army - all dead little nyys' army - lost two groks Oh yeah, and did I forget to mention that I had control of both the move +2 and defense +1 glyph for almost the entire game? It was a flat out woopin', nothing else to be said for it. So now I'm not sure if I should be upset since I was so handily defeated by a six year old, or if I should be proud that the little guy is starting to make good decisions? Probably the most telling will be how he plays in the next game, as I suppose it's possible that some of the great moves my son made during the game were coincidental. -insert signature here- |

Re: nyys Battle Reports *Traitorous D20 7/15/09*
So the tides are starting to turn a bit with the ole D20 rolls against little nyys.
Last night we played on Viper Valley. nyys Mohicans x3 Brave Arrow Venocs x3 Venoc Warlord 500 - 20 hexes little nyys Grimnak Blade Gruts x4 Ne-Gok-Sa Kee-Mo-Shi 500 - 20 hexes With the small footprint on this map I decided to strike first with the Mohicans. I figured with the Gruts move of six they'd be on top of me before I knew it and I would only benefit from ranged attacks for a brief time. I was right, the Gruts charged up the hill (on the right) along with Grimnak and started bludgeoning then Mohicans. It was a pretty even battle, we were basically going figure for figure as far as kills were concerned. The key to my continued survival was placement of figures such that Grimnak couldn't move up the hill and make it to the other side (and in turn no Chomp). Double spacers can get to all points of the map, but they can be blocked with proper placement. So instead of taking the long way around, little nyys decides to park the big dino on the defense glyph in the middle of the map. Great... As predicted, the Gruts suddenly got a lot harder to kill. All while I was focused on the Gruts with the Mohicans, my son snuck a single Grut to the opposite side of the map and engaged the pack of Vipers I was holding in reserve. In hindsight I probably should have charged them (the Vipers) out first. With a move of nine they would have been in the opposite start zone in two turns. Instead, one by one they were hacked apart. Unable to disengage (without a swipe) I had no choice but to leave them where they were. It also didn't help that their attacks were feable at best and I didn't roll a single Frenzy the whole game. So basically what happens is the game comes down to a full life VW, a twice wounded Brave Arrow, and one Tribemans against the tank, Ne-Gok-Sa (no wounds). The VW and NGS engage on some open ground and start pounding. They exchange wounds and eventually the VW is down to one wound with NGS having three remaining (with all Mindshakle rolls failing). Figuring the VW won't last three OMs I decide to put OM #3 on Brave Arrow and move him adjacent. So my son says: "well, since the VW has one wound left and Brave Arrow has two, I'm going to Mindshackle Brave Arrow." Rolls the D20 and... 20! So suddenly my army is cut in half as far as wounds remaining is concerned. NGS attacks the VW... dead! Brave Arrow (in the next round) turns on his own brother and cuts down The Last Mohican. Curse you Mindshakle... and the D20!!!!! -insert signature here- |

Re: nyys Battle Reports *Big Z Gone Wild 7/17/09*
In the dozen or so games that I've played with Zelrig, Big Z has been all hit or all miss, with the latter being the usual of late. Yesterday those tides turned significantly...
nyys Zelrig Legion x5 Marcus marcu 555 - 24 hexes little nyys Dzu-Teh x2 Dwarves x3 Migol Ne-Gok-Sa 560 - 20 hexes This was one of those games that I'll have to call a learning experience for the little guy. We played on a new snow map that I created (not posted anywhere yet), that stayed within the confines of the recent GenCon Map Contest restrictions, though it was just long enough to prevent a 1st turn strike by the Z-man. I get initiative and send Z out first, but still too far away to shoot anything. Unfortuantely little nyys' 1st OMs were on the Dzu-Teh and their measley move of 5, which wasn't enough to get them engaged to Zelrig. My next OM, I fire into the center of his Dwarf Pack and roll three skulls for Majestic Fires... five dead Dwarves. Next OM he glacier traverses and gets a Dzu-Teh adjacent to Z, and puts two wounds on him. I disengage (missed swipe) and roll three skulls again with MF... four more dead Dwarves. A couple more wounds and a disengagement later, big Z is down to one life, but does not succumb to the Dzu-Teh onslaught before taking out the rest of the Dwarves and one snow man. From there I still have 20 Legionnaires and Marcus up against Migol, Ne-Gok-Sa, and a couple straggling commons. Not even a NGS mindshackle would turn this tide. We played it out, but in the end the Legion decimated what was left. The game was so lopsided, even a little nyys had to laugh, just one of those games the Dice Gods hate you (or love you depending on your PoV). What happened in this game is exactly what makes the Z-man so scary. But I've also played games where he's done next to nothing due to wiffing the MF roll a couple times, or plain ole good play from my opponent. This particular day was the Day of the Dragon. -insert signature here- |
